A building in a location is equipped with a heat pump system that is used for space heating in winter and cooling in summer. The seasonal COPs of the heat pump in winter and summer are estimated to be 2.2 and 2.8, respectively. The design heating load of the house is calculated to be 750,000 kJ/h for an indoor temperature of 25°C. The unit cost of electricity is $0.09/kWh. The annual heating degree-days in this location is 2400°C-days and the 97.5% winter design temperature is −9°C. The cooling degree-days are 1100°C-days. Determine the annual electricity consumption and its cost for heating and cooling of this house. Assume the same overall heat loss coefficient for winter and summer.
